  Looking back at what's commented out in my xorg.conf file, I tried the
following:

#       DisplaySize  672 378
#       DisplaySize  16 9
#       DisplaySize  160 90

  With each of these I saw some scaling (which broke interlacing, IIRC)
and xdpyinfo reported a different size to the one in the config file.
I'll give your setting a shot when I get a chance, though.

  Out of curiosity, do you find that xdpyinfo reports the correct
display size?
